diff --git a/README.md b/README.md index 18c3fc8e..35d525f6 100644 --- a/README.md +++ b/README.md @@ -8,11 +8,13 @@ Garm enables you to create and automatically maintain pools of [self-hosted GitH The goal of ```garm``` is to be simple to set up, simple to configure and simple to use. It is a single binary that can run on any GNU/Linux machine without any other requirements other than the providers it creates the runners in. It is intended to be easy to deploy in any environment and can create runners in any system you can write a provider for. There is no complicated setup process and no extremely complex concepts to understant. Once set up, it's meant to stay out of your way. +Garm supports creating pools on either GitHub itself or on your own deployment of [GitHub Enterprise Server](https://docs.github.com/en/enterprise-server@3.5/admin/overview/about-github-enterprise-server).
